Micron Technology has sales offices located in four cities: Dallas, Seattle, Boston, and Los Angeles. An analysis of the company's accounts receivables reveals the number of overdue invoices by days, as shown here.
 
  Days Overdue Dallas Seattle Boston Los Angeles
  Under 30 days 137 122 198 287
  30-60 days 85 46 76 109
  61-90 days 33 27 55 48
  Over 90 days 18 32 45 66
 
  Assume the invoices are stored and managed from a central database.
 
  What is the probability that a randomly selected invoice from the database is from the Boston sales office?
  A) 0.2702
  B) 0.0231
  C) 0.3461
  D) 0.7765

Amoebae are the simplest type of protozoans, and are characterized by a feeding and dividing trophozoite stage that moves by temporary extensions called pseudopodia or false feet.
